Totalitarianism is known as a form of government and also a type of political system that hinders all opposition parties. They also outlaws individual opposition to the state and its claims, and exercises.
Some of the characteristics of totalitarianism are:
- Their methods of Enforcement includes police terror, indoctrination etc.
- They make use of Modern Technology such as mass communication to spread propaganda, advanced military weapons etc.
